James Culley

James Culley was born in Hamilton, Ohio, and grew up in Cincinnati. He received a bachelor's degree from the Oberlin Conservatory, a bachelor of arts degree in Classics (Latin) from Oberlin College, and a master's degree from the Eastman School of Music. He joined the faculty at the University of Cincinnati in 1979 as an original member of The Percussion Group Cincinnati. With that group he has recorded and performed throughout the U.S. and abroad. He has directed the CCM Percussion Ensemble for the past 20 years. The ensemble promotes new works by CCM student composers and specializes in performances of unconducted, full-score pieces. In 1998 he received the Ernest Glover Outstanding Faculty (CCM) award. Culley has performed as extra percussionist in the Cincinnati Symphony and Cincinnati Opera orchestras, and freelances as timpanist/percussionist in regional orchestras.
